Aerobic Exercise
Physical exercise of low to high intensity that depends primarily on the aerobic energy-generating process, such as running or cycling.
Strength Training
A type of physical exercise specializing in the use of resistance to induce muscular contraction, which builds strength, anaerobic endurance, and muscle size.
MyPlate
A visual guide created by the U.S. Department of Agriculture to help Americans understand and follow healthy eating habits, showing the five food groups as sections on a plate.
2,000-Calorie
A reference dietary intake level often used in nutrition labeling, suggesting the estimated amount of calories a person should consume daily for maintaining weight.
